2: On page 268, Rasinski and Padak (2013) write, "The entire class reads the text chorally several times. The teacher creates variety by having students read different verses or portions of the texts in groups." Choral reading is when students read the same text at the same time out loud. Read this web article for more information about choral reading. Choral reading is a preferable strategy to popcorn reading, or round robin reading; which is deemed as ineffective by many reading experts and reading teachers.
